Security InstallationManagementAs a result of many years collective experiencegained in the British and Iraqi militaries andthe private security sector, our personnel areable to plan, advise and oversee installationof the full range of security measures requiredin areas and locations that may be of interestto undesirable people, such as criminals orterrorists, or to people with assets which theywant protected. This can include the sightingof CCT V cameras, the location of guard postsand their physical construction, the planningand structuring of control rooms and thecomplete start -up of man - guarding shifts.
Where possible we employ an “ intell igentbuilding ” style of thinking whereby we tryand combine the best avai lable systemsand practices to the available budget andin-country resources.
The considerations of threat, vulnerability andimpact are then used to compile a risk matrix,which in turn identifies the security shortfalls andwhere the client needs to prioritize it’s resources.The risk matrix is used to determine the physicaland other security needs for the site.

Security Surveysand AuditsThis process involves a detailed inspection of abusiness, military installation or industrial siteand work processes in order to identify physicalor procedural weaknesses, and then makerecommendations for improvements. As with allprojects, Al Sajer develops its approach from acomprehensive threat analysis. This specificallylooks at threats on the basis of their capabilityto impact upon a client and their motivationto do so.
A full security survey is then undertaken toassess vulnerabilities to these threats. Oursurveys employ the concentric circles ofprotection principle that creates the greatestform of defense to counter specific threat thathave been identified by our threat analysis team.The survey examines a full range of physicalissues such as access control and alarmsystems, through CCTV and other surveillancedevices, to having a close look at proceduralvulnerabilities like deliveries, visits by workmenor any other type of potentially hostile intrusion.The survey is then combined with the threatassessment and discussions are held with theclient to identify the impact of various securityincident scenarios.
